'This Side Up' Cube Timer

Fcxfcfcf

Very cool.

No moving parts makes me swoon.

From the website:

    Cube Timer

    It’s preset for 5, 15, 30 and 60 minutes.

    To activate, simply turn the cube so the time you want is facing up.

    Great for timing phone calls, cooking, meetings, exercise — even a quick power nap!

    No buttons to press, no dials to set!

    Alarm beeps when the time is up.

    Numbers are easily readable.

    Batteries included.

    Black plastic.

    2-1/2" cube.

$14.99.
